|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 13538 人关注过本帖
标题:[求助]在VBA里怎么给单元格赋值?
只看楼主 加入收藏
cbld520
Rank: 1
等 级:新手上路
帖 子:1
专家分:0
注 册:2005-4-19
收藏
 问题点数:0 回复次数:6 
[求助]在VBA里怎么给单元格赋值?
我是一个菜鸟,我现在在Excel 2000里有一个很棘手的问题需要解决,想请各位大侠赐教!谢谢!

我在工具栏上自定义了一个按钮(此按钮需要指定一个宏),当活动单元格移动到任一位置时,点击此按钮,该单元格内就自动写入(或插入)了我要填写的内容(内容包括任何字符)。此功能有点类似与“插入特殊符号”的功能。在该宏里就需要写入一段程序,但是在程序里指定单元格坐标位置时,由于坐标是一个变量(可能在“F5”也可能在“N28”),所以就需要用“当前单元格”的命令代替指定单元格坐标位置的命令。现在想请教各位大侠,是否有这样的命令?如果有,这个宏又该怎么写?
搜索更多相关主题的帖子: 赋值 VBA 单元 
2005-06-07 10:45
疯子
Rank: 1
等 级:新手上路
帖 子:4
专家分:0
注 册:2005-11-12
收藏
得分:0 

我也急着想知道答案,因为我编了一个宏,在SEEK到我需要的单元格后,我要获得此单元格的坐标来定位此行内相应的数据单元。

2005-11-12 12:27
禹_二
Rank: 1
等 级:新手上路
帖 子:661
专家分:0
注 册:2006-9-13
收藏
得分:0 
vb6论坛好像很冷清,没有高手解决问题.

2006-10-31 21:13
bestfeng
Rank: 3Rank: 3
等 级:新手上路
威 望:7
帖 子:179
专家分:0
注 册:2006-10-31
收藏
得分:0 
谁说的,主要是第首不会,高手潜水。
Set t = Sheet1.CommandButton1.TopLeftCell
With ActiveWindow
.ScrollRow = t.Row
.ScrollColumn = t.Column
End With
2006-11-01 15:46
白鹭缘
Rank: 1
等 级:新手上路
帖 子:3
专家分:0
注 册:2008-11-11
收藏
得分:0 
Selection就可以标识当前选中的单元格.eg:Selection=100,则当前选中的单元格就被写入100.
就这么简单.
2008-11-11 16:56
clrvba
Rank: 1
等 级:新手上路
帖 子:2
专家分:0
注 册:2008-11-21
收藏
得分:0 
回复
我就是个菜鸟, 可是还有比我还CAI的鸟啊, 我们一起学习, 一起进步吧

如果你想付给表Sheet1的单元格 "B2" 的值为100, 就写

Sheets("Sheet1").range("B2")=100
2008-11-21 16:42
pariszh
该用户已被删除
收藏
得分:0 
提示: 作者被禁止或删除 内容自动屏蔽
2008-11-21 17:59
快速回复:[求助]在VBA里怎么给单元格赋值?
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.025638 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ved